    Pressing certain keybuttons on the laptop automatically loops the "-" button


    Yesterday, there was an issue with my laptop's "space" button. Every time I hit "spacebar" it makes space and then automatically types "-" which turns into a loop like this -------------------------------------------------------. This won't stop until you start typing anything else, pressing other buttons on the keyboard. However, later I found out that it also loops when I press:1. Arrow up2. Arrow down3. 0 on the numpad4. Left Ctrl5. Left Shift6. Z7. B8. N9. EnterIf I click on the "-" it doesn't loop. It just adds it one time. However, the "-" doesn't work at all on the side of the numpad.

  2. Windows 10 automatic repair fail loop

    Hi,

    We understand your concern and we will provide the assistance required to help resolve the issue.

    I suggest that you perform Power Drain which will help you skip the reboot loop and help you access the PC. To perform Power Drain, refer to the steps below

    • Unplug the charger and remove the battery of your laptop, if using a desktop remove the power cord.
    • Press and hold the Power button for 30sec
    • Plug the charger/power cord and restart system.

    Zippy! Automatic Button Pressing program.

    Warning: This application may be considered malicious by some anti-virus software and the like because it operates using a keylogger and can simulate keystrokes and mouse clicks.

    Warning 2: Some anti-cheat software like Punkbuster and/or Valve Anti-Cheat (VAC) may flag this application as a hack, cheat, or otherwise unwanted. This application should be off (not in the system tray) when playing anti-cheat protected games.

    Zippy! basically either holds keys/mouse buttons or pushes them rapidly. It is very useful in games like Minecraft where you have to hold a key frequently in order to perform an action.


    Pressing certain keybuttons on the laptop automatically loops the "-" button [​IMG]


    On/Off Key: When pressed, activates and deactivates the selected profile.

    Profile Up Key: When pressed, selects the next profile. If "On" it will automatically deactivate previous and activate the newly selected profile.

    Profile Down Key: When pressed, selects the previous profile. If "On" it will automatically deactivate previous and activate the newly selected profile.

    Start in Tray: When checked, will automatically hide Zippy! in the system tray.

    Add/Remove Profile: Adds or removes a profile. All actions under a single profile will be activated when the profile is activated.

    Add Row: Adds a row to the selected row.

    To delete a row, click on the row in the left-most column (where the arrow is) and then hit the delete key.

    Device & Key/Button Name: Double click on either column to bring up the "Get Input" dialog. Press the key or click the mouse button you want to use in box (key doesn't have to be in box but mouse does) to assign it.

    Delay: 0 is the same as holding a key down. Any number greater than 0 causes a cycling pattern. For example, if it is 5000, it will press and release the key, wait 5 seconds, press and release the key, wait 5 seconds, press and release the key, etc.


    It saves/loads all settings when opening/closing the application.
